Plumbing and Gas Products for Real Work Sites
Plumbing and gas jobs need dependable parts. A small wrong part can delay a repair or stop a project. The listed catalog includes PVC, CPVC, copper, and PEX pipes. It also includes valves, elbows, reducers, unions, meters, regulators, hoses, faucets, and drainage items. The company lists these products for residential, commercial, and industrial settings.
This mix can help maintenance teams, builders, and facility managers. Before ordering, buyers should check size, pressure needs, material type, and local rules. Clear details help prevent returns and job delays. They also help workers finish tasks with fewer surprises. This is helpful when a schedule is tight.

Quality, Standards, and Product Checks
A low price is not helpful if a product fails on the job. Buyers should look at fit, strength, safety needs, and listed standards before ordering. PLG Supplies says its plumbing and gas items follow relevant U.S. standards, including ASTM, ANSI, and ASME.
Its public terms also say product details may change, so buyers should review descriptions before purchase. This is a normal part of smart buying. The best approach is simple. Match each item to the job, read the details, and ask questions when a product must meet a strict rule. Careful checks protect both workers and budgets.

Simple Tips Before You Place an Order
A smart order starts before checkout. First, write down the exact task or site need. Next, check product size, count, material, and use. Then review delivery needs and storage space. Also check return rules before buying items in large amounts. The company lists returns for unused and unopened goods within a set window, with approval needed first.
Some items may not be returnable. This is important for medical goods, custom orders, and clearance products. A few careful minutes can prevent waste, delay, and extra cost. Good notes also help the next person order correctly. This gives every order a cleaner paper trail.
